Skin symptoms are similar to Rhus toxicodendron and it has proven itself a valuable antidote to poison oak or poison ivy.N ervous dyspepsia, relieved by food. Impaired memory, depression, and irritability; diminution of senses (smell, sight, hearing).Fear of examination in students. Weakening of all senses, sight, hearing, etc. Aversion to work; lacks self-confidence; irresistible desire to swear and curse. Sensation of a plug in various parts - eyes, rectum, bladder, etc.; also of a band. Empty feeling in stomach; Eating temporarily relieves all discomfort. BETTER, from eating, when lying on side, from rubbing. WORSE, on application of hot water. |
